The straightness and perpendicularity of each reference surface (4 surfaces) are finished with high precision to within 1μm at 300mm!
We would like to introduce our calibration equipment, the '311 Series Ultra-Precision Right Angle Master UM.' This master can be used to measure the straightness and squareness of the movements of precision measuring instruments such as machine tools and three-dimensional measuring machines, as well as the straightness and squareness of high-precision parts that have been precisely machined. All four surfaces are finished using ultra-precision lapping technology developed with gauge blocks, allowing it to be used as a reference surface. 【Specifications (Excerpt)】 ■311-111 UM-110 ・Nominal dimensions (W×L×T) (mm): 90×110×25 ・Squareness tolerance (μm): Reference surface 1, side surface 5 ・Straightness tolerance (μm): Reference surface 1, side surface 5 ・Weight (kg): 1.5 *For more details, please download the PDF or feel free to contact us.

Suzusho Co., Ltd. was founded in 1955 as a metalworking company in Nakatsugawa, Gifu Prefecture. Later, it also started operations as a machinery and tool trading company, embarking on a genuine journey closely connected to the local community and manufacturing industry. As the industrial landscape of Nakatsugawa evolved, the company continued to grow and develop, and now, as a "comprehensive trading company for production technology," it has built a solid track record throughout Gifu Prefecture and the southern Shinshu/Kiso area of Nagano Prefecture.
